我已经为salesforce force.com 平台安装了独立的IDE。在尝试启动 ide 时,我得到"JVM 终止。退出代码=-1"错误。知道此错误代码是什么意思吗?
这是 IDE force.com 常见的加载错误。
有不同的解决方案。尝试以下任一方法:
A) 更改工作区位置。
或
B)(一)。从链接安装 Eclipse 3.6 for Java Developers (Helios) http://www.eclipse.org/downloads/packages/eclipse-ide-java-developers/heliossr2从右侧窗口中单击您的操作系统。
(ii). 使用以下链接,按照说明安装 Eclipse 3.6 Force.com IDE 插件 http://wiki.developerforce.com/page/Force.com_IDE_Installation_for_Eclipse_3.6
或
C) 在缺省 Force.com IDE 安装目录中:
C:Program Filessalesforce.comForce.com IDE
找到配置文件:
forceide
并在文件末尾注释掉以下内容(注意前导#):
#-vmargs
#-Dfile.encoding=UTF-8
#-Xms256m
#-Xmx1024m
#-XX:PermSize=128M
#-XX:MaxPermSize=512M
我希望它现在有效。
干杯!
这可能是由于各种原因。比如说,如果你没有足够的内存(RAM),如配置文件(forceide.ini)中指定的那样。如此链接中所述 Force.com IDE – JVM终止 ,可能会将配置文件中的MaxPermSize
减少到256M并检查。
几天前,这件事发生在我身上。我的设置是:
- 视窗 7 64 位
- JRE7 64 位
- Force.com IDE 64 位
当我运行java自动更新来更新我的jre时,它安装了32位版本(完全不同的抱怨)。所以我手动下载了 64 位版本的 jre 安装在 32 位版本的顶部,IDE 再次开始工作。